SCSU Shows Well in 2-1 Loss to #15 Winona State
The St. Cloud State women’s soccer team played its home opener versus #15 Winona State University on Sunday afternoon in front of 163 spectators at Husky Stadium. The Huskies stuck with the Warriors until the end but were defeated by a score of 2 to 1.
Winona State struck first with a goal at the 11:26 mark. Preseason pick for NSIC Offensive player of the Year, sophomore forward Jennifer DeRoo put the Warriors up 1-0. Senior Melissa Sellier had an assist on the goal. Winona State went up 2-0 when senior forward Sarah Colleran found the back of the net at 54:51. Assisting on the Warriors second goal was sophomore Rebecca McCoy.
The Huskies made things close on a nice goal by senior midfielder Laura Moline at 73:54. She beat Warrior goalkeeper Anna Belpedio on a long kick that found the right corner of the net. Junior Mary Morhardt was credited with an assist on the goal.
Sophomore goalkeeper Kenzie Hanzlik had seven saves on the day for SCSU.
The Huskies (0-2-0, 0-0-0 NSIC) next play on the road at Southwest Minnesota on Sept. 10 at 12:00 pm. Their next home match will be Sept. 17 at 1:00 pm, once again taking on Southwest Minnesota.
